SYDNEY, Nov. 19 (Xinhua) -- An earthquake with a magnitude of 6.4 jolted 74 km off Tadine, New Caledonia on Sunday, the U.S. Geological Survey (USGS) said.
The earthquake, which struck at 09:25:50 UTC, was initially determined to be at 21.576 degrees south latitude and 168.606 degrees east longitude with a depth of 25.3 km.
The Pacific Tsunami Warning Center did not issue tsunami alert after the shock.
